Government College, Bhabra Application Process

The application process of Government College, Bhabra is very simple and accessible to all the candidates eligible for admission. Here are the details of the application process:

  • The admissions: The college notifies the opening of the admission process through various media, including the college website and local newspapers.
  • Application form: Students seeking admission can access the application form either by visiting the office of the college or can collect from the web portal of Department of Higher Education, Madhya Pradesh: www.mphighereducation.nic.in.
  • Form Fill-up: The Government College, Bhabra application form should be duly filled in correctly and in its entirety. Personal details, academic qualifications, and course preference must be filled out correctly.
  • Submission of Documents: In addition to the filled-up application form.
  • Application: Submission the filled application form with all the required documents to the college admission office before the specified date.
  • Merit List Preparation: The college prepares a merit list based on marks and other criteria from the qualifying examination, as per government regulations
  • List of Merits: The College publishes the Merit list over the college board and also gets published on their website.
  • Document verification: Candidates in the short listed list are instructed to appear to the college administration for document verification on the dated specified.
  • Payment Fees: After final verification, fees are to be paid by all the candidates if they want admission in the allotted seat.
  • Admission Confirmation: Once the fees are paid and all formalities are completed, the admission is confirmed, and students can collect their admission letter from the college office.

Government College, Bhabra B.Com Admission Process

The college offers a B.Com programme for those who want to make a career in commerce and business. B.Com admission is generally on the basis of marks obtained in 10+2 examination, though it gives priority to students who have studied commerce or related subjects in their higher secondary education.

Government College, Bhabra B.Sc Admission Process

  • B.Sc Botany, Chemistry, and Zoology programme focuses on life sciences. Eligibility for Government College, Bhabra admission requires students to have completed 10+2 with Physics, Chemistry, and Biology as main subjects. The selection is based on the merit of marks obtained in these subjects in the qualifying examination.
  • The student who has done 10+2 with subjects like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ics can apply for B.Sc Chemistry, Mathematics, and Physics course. Admission for such a programme is given through merit in marks scored for the above-mentioned subjects in the qualifying examination.

Government College, Bhabra Documents Required

  • Original and photocopy of 10th and 12th mark sheets
  • Transfer Certificate issued by the institution last attended
  • Character Certificate
  • Caste Certificate (if applicable)
  • Recent passport-size photographs
